Position Summary:
We have an exciting opportunity to join our team as a Administrative Manager - Pulmonary Division **Manhattan**.

In this role, the successful candidate will report to the Division Administrator and will assist with the administration and management of all aspects of the division in accordance with departmental and institutional objectives. In partnership with the divisional leadership team, the candidates primary responsibility will be to improve and ensure divisional effectiveness by providing analytical and operational support for the divisions administrative functions.

Job Responsibilities:

    • CLINICAL AFFAIRS MANAGEMENT The candidate will work directly with the Division Administrator in the
      administrative oversight of daily practice operations and assist with the coordination of service operations of
      faculty group practice and clinical operations. The candidate will review key performance indicators, current
      workflows, productivity and service quality expectations and will analyze, assess and identify process
      improvement opportunities, assist in implementing change, and coordinate activities to obtain expected results and
      meet targeted performance metrics. In addition the candidate will have primary responsibility for oversight and
      supervision of practice staff including recruiting, training, and management. The candidate will monitor compliance
      to established regulations and guidelines.
      * PROGRAM DEVELOPMENT & SPECIAL PROJECTS The candidate will assist with coordination, planning,
      implementation and follow-up of the top priorities for the division and will provide strategic support to the
      leadership team to achieve divisional initiatives and special projects.
      * FINANCIAL MANAGEMENT The candidate will perform financial analysis and strategic planning under the
      direction of the divisional administrator with the overall goal of optimizing divisional financial processes, operations
      and resource allocation. The candidate will liaison with various institutional teams related to program planning and
      financial management issues.
      * FACULTY AFFAIRS & SUPPORT The candidate will work with the Division Administrator to provide ongoing
      administrative support focusing on transactions and processes for faculty including recruitment, appointment, and
      promotions.
      * GRANT MANAGEMENT In this role, the candidate will work with the Division Administrator to provide pre- and
      post-award management for division faculty for federal and non-federal grants and contracts. This candidate will
      share responsibility for oversight of all components of the grants cycle, including pre-award budget development,
      post-award monitoring, program subcontract management, and grant closeout procedures.
